#!/bin/python3 import sys def fact(n): if n==1: return 1 else: return n*fact(n-1) def countArray(n, k, x): temp = fact(k-1) temp *= (n-2) if x<=k: return temp-1 else: return temp if __name__ == "__main__": n, k, x = input().strip().split(' ') n, k, x = [int(n), int(k), int(x)] answer = countArray(n, k, x) print(answer)